The international festival of photojournalism-Visa pour l’Image-just took place in Perpignan, France. This festival exhibited the work of 3,000 photojournalists, showing their photographs through 26 different exhibitions across the city. All images in the running for prizes were captured over the years and feature images that touch on the heartbreaking news, as well as the more celebratory stories around the world.
This year’s Arthus-Bertrand Visa d’or News Award winner was Tyler Hicks. His photograph was an eye-opening look into the Nairobi, Kenya mall massacre. It depicts a mother sheltering her young children from gunfire.
